大小端模式

来源:互联网 发布:文学书籍推荐知乎 编辑:程序博客网 时间:2024/06/05 06:15

    这是ARM手册里对大端模式的描述,可以看出大端模式下的高地址放低字节数据,低地址放高字节数据,这里放置的单位是字节,上面的图中表格也很清楚的说明了,表格中的数指的是数据的第几个byte  ,从下到上是地址增长的方式,而从左到右是32位数据线的地址由高到低的变化,于是这一组数据线可以表示4个字节,但是cpu只管一个地址对应一个字节,这是对奇的问题了。 上面表格中也可以看出byte 0 (数据的地位字节)被放在了地址的高位中(31-24)这相当于地址3  (地址从0开始)。它这个数据占用了12个字节。。。不知道是什么类型的数据。下面是小端模式,可以对比一下




原创粉丝点击